Summary

The extreme vulnerability of the Caribbean Region was highlighted once again in 2017. Many of Caribbean Development Bank's (CDB) Borrowing Member Countries (BMCs) were affected by the hurricanes that passed through the Caribbean in September.

Notwithstanding the devastating events of 2017, there was an overall uptick in economic growth to 0.6%.

Although growth returned in 2017, the Region continues to underperform in comparison with other country groups.
Looking ahead, the Region is expected to grow by 2% in 2018, benefiting from a projected increase in global economic growth, but risks are tilted on the downside.
